Elektronic signature
What does it mean?
Electronic signature is designed to be used for signing electronic documents and to create a signature in the sense of a hand written one on a paper document.
The EU Directive 1999/93/EC for electronic signatures says that “electronic signature means data in electronic form which are attached to or logically associated with other electronic data and which serve as a method of authentication.
Advanced electronic signature means an electronic signature which meets the following requirements:
- it is uniquely linked to the signatory
- it is capable of identifying the signatory
- it is created using means that the signatory can maintain under his sole control, and
- it is linked to the data to which it relates in such a manner that any subsequent change of the data is detectable
Electronic signature presupposes the use of electronic certificates. Most often the term digital signature is used analogous with electronic signature.
